Rs. 1 bn for developing Jaffna, Eastern universities
May 4, 2012, 10:18 pm, The Island
 

by Franklin R. Satyapalan
 
     The government has set 
aside funds for the development of the  Jaffna and Eastern universities.
 The construction of the Agriculture and  Engineering faculties on a 
500-acre block of land at Arivu Nagar (City of  Knowledge) in 
Kilinochchi, with a Rs. 500 mn grant from the Indian government  and a 
Rs. 500 million allocations from the Sri Lankan government would 
commence  shortly, Secretary to the Ministry of Higher Education Dr. 
Sunil Jayantha  Navaratne said.
 
  He said the Minister of 
Higher Education S. B. Dissanayake  accompanied by Indian High 
Commissioner in Sri Lanka Ashok K. Kanth would visit  the site in 
Kilinochchi on Monday, May 07 and meet the Vice Chancellor (VC) of  the 
Jaffna University Prof. Vasanthi Arasaratnam and Government Agent of  
Kilinochchi Mrs Rupawathi Ketheeswaran in taking forward the project.
 
 He
 said that President Mahinda Rajapaksa had advised the  Minister 
Dissanayake not to delay the project as the area had been deprived of  
development over the past three decades due to the war.
 
 He said the Government would allocate supplementary funding for  the project in the 2013 Budget.
 
 The
 Vice Chancellor of the Eastern University Prof. K.  Kobindarajah said 
that he was looking forward to the proposed development as  peace among 
the communities could be achieved through the field of education.
